What is mediation?

Mediation is the procedure whereby families can discuss concerning future arrangements for children with the help of a neutral third party. The arbitrator does not tell celebrations what to do, however can aid the events to reach their own contracts amicably, whilst trying to improve interaction in between them.

Are any kind of arrangements made via mediation legally binding?

Any kind of arrangements made throughout mediation are not legitimately binding in the feeling of being enforceable in a court. Some people do choose to get a solicitor to look over the agreement, and also the agreement can be utilized in court at a later phase in order to create a Consent Order. What is a Mediation Information and Assessment Meeting (MIAM)?

A Mediation Information Assessment Satisfying is the initial meeting which will certainly help develop whether mediation will be suitable in your situations, and whether it will aid you to reach an agreement.

What will take place at mediation?

The mediator will certainly try to locate typical ground in between you. If you’re not comfortable with being in the very same area as your ex-partner, the moderator can set up ‘shuttle bus’ mediation.

Upon an agreement being reached in between you as well as your ex-partner, a “memorandum of understanding” will be created by the arbitrator so everyone comprehends what has actually been agreed.

What can I anticipate from my arbitrator?

A family conciliator have to act impartially and prevent any problem of interest. A moderator needs to stay neutral on the end result of the mediation.

You should also expect the conciliator to maintain confidential all details acquired throughout the training course of mediation. The moderator can not even reveal details to the court, without the consent of both participants. The mediators might just reveal details where there are major accusations of damage to a Child or grownup.

Mediation is a voluntary process and any kind of session for mediation can be suspended or ended, if it is felt that the celebrations are unwilling to completely take part in the process. Mediators have to additionally motivate the participants to think about the wishes and also feelings of the children.

When looking for a moderator, we would encourage seeking one that has gotten the Family Mediation Council Certification. This is the the fully-qualified standing for family mediators in England as well as Wales. Achieving FMCA needs effective completion of an approved training program, plus a period of supervised method bring about submission of a portfolio successfully evaluated causing FMCA.

For how long can mediation take?

Mediation can proceed while it meets the needs of the private events entailed. The preliminary conference lasts approximately 45 mins. Full mediation sessions will usually last between 1 to 2 hours, depending on the complexity of the situation.

How will the Family Mediator client know we have all the financial details?

Financial disclosure is among the stages of Family Mediation.

Each client will certainly have a financial disclosure kind to complete in addition to sustaining files.

Each customer will certainly have the chance to see the various other persons financial disclosure.

If the assets are complicated, financial professionals as well as valuers can be included.

What happens if there is a power discrepancy in between the Family Mediation customers?

Family Mediators are educated to handle power discrepancies.

In the joint sessions the Family Arbitrator will certainly make certain that both clients are heard and also do not interrupt each other.

The Family Mediator will inspect throughout that you both recognize what is being gone over which there is a reasonable equilibrium in between the customers throughout the conversations.

I do not want to be in the exact same area as my former companion what choices exist to still mediate?

At the intake session we can discuss “Shuttle Mediation’ with you.

In this Family Mediation design each customer will remain in a separate space and the conciliator goes from room to space to bring each message to see if propositions can be reached.

Often the mediation might start as a shuttle mediation and also for the later sessions the clients might determine to attempt remaining in the same room together if progress is being made.

We can likewise talk about if any Family Mediation special factors to consider need to be in place e.g. showing up and leaving at various times as well as the clients waiting in different waiting areas prior to the Family Mediation starts.

What is a Separating Parenting Information Programme (SPIP)?

The Separated Parenting Information Programme (SPIP) are workshops for separated parents to attend. The course is made to make sure that you would certainly not attend the same program as your former companion.

The workshops aid parents to concentrate on their children as well as to consider things from the sight of the Child.

The program can additionally be a court ordered task to inform the parent experiencing a separation how their practices can have an effect on the Child. The SPIP aims to reduce any kind of conflict that the Child may be experiencing between the separating parents.
